Hey all,
I'll be out of town most of June / July but I'd like to do some car camping in my 60 this summer (maybe late July / Aug) and looking for some good options that aren't too far from PDX (maybe within 100-150 mile perimeter?). I don't mind doing some off road driving either but don't want any trails that are too technical (rock crawling / spotting, etc).
Can anyone provide any local recommendations for some nice / quiet / off road camping sites?
If you can point me in the direction of any recommended websites or locations, I'd appreciate it.

Do you have the iOverlander app? Lot's of camping suggestions there. Within 150 mile of Portland there must be thousands of places. Hit a forest service road and explore. Be sure to let us know what you find!
 
Are you OK with primitive sites i.e. without potable water or bathroom? If so, all throughout the Mt Hood and Willamette NF are good spots. There are two books titled Camp Free with meticulously catalogued info and maps.
 
You should definitely check out the RoadTrippers app. It has everything cool including campsites , abandoned places to explore, funky places, restaurants, etc, etc. I used it on a cross country motorcycle trip years back and used it daily.
